Whether you're an owner of reptiles, a lover of carnivorous pets or a bird enthusiast, frozen feeder quail can serve as a critical component of the diet you give your pet.

Feeder quail, also known as frozen feeder quail in the market, is a healthy food choice for carnivorous pets. Feeder quails are filled with protein, vitamins, and minerals that contribute to a stronger, active and healthier pet.

Often, novice caretakers wonder, "Where's the best place to purchase feeder quail?". The good news is, feeder quails are easily obtainable, both in stores and on the internet.

If you are probing for places to purchase affordable feeder quails, consider visiting digital marketplaces such as Amazon and eBay. These interactive platforms offer a variety of options to choose from, allowing you to find the most suitable feeder quails for your pet's dietary needs.

Another reliable place to buy feeder quails is from specialty pet shops or neighborhood feed stores. These locations often stock feeder quails bred in monitored environments, ensuring they are safe, clean and suitable for your pet's diet.

When it comes to affordability, buying feeder quails in bulk is a intelligent move. Most suppliers provide price reductions for bulk buying, saving you a noteworthy amount on pet food expenses.

However, while buying feeder quails, make here sure you pay attention to the quality. The cheapest option might not always be the healthiest for your pet. Therefore, always opt for trusted brands and reputable suppliers when purchasing feeder quails.

To summarize, providing your pet with feeder quails can significantly improve their health. They are readily available and affordable, making them an excellent inclusion to your pet's diet. By focusing on quality and selecting your supplier carefully, you can ensure your pet gets the healthiest and most fitting diet possible.
